Job Title - Traffic Marshal / Banksman
Location - BS11
Job Overview
We are looking for a reliable and safety-conscious Traffic Marshal / Banksman to join our team on a busy construction site. The successful candidate will be responsible for managing the safe movement of vehicles, plant and pedestrians around the site.
You will work closely with site management, drivers, plant operators and other site personnel to maintain a safe and organised working environment.
Key Responsibilities
- Direct and control the movement of vehicles entering, leaving and moving around the site.
- Safely guide HGVs, delivery vehicles, plant and other vehicles into designated areas.
- Assist drivers with reversing and manoeuvring where required.
- Maintain clear separation between pedestrians, vehicles and site operations.
- Use appropriate hand signals and communication methods when directing vehicles.
- Monitor site access and ensure vehicles follow designated routes.
- Assist with deliveries and ensure vehicles are positioned safely.
- Maintain a clean, safe and organised traffic management area.
- Report hazards, unsafe behaviour, accidents or near misses to the Site Manager.
- Follow all site traffic management plans, RAMS and health & safety procedures.
- Ensure visitors, delivery drivers and contractors follow site safety requirements.
- Wear appropriate PPE and maintain high standards of site safety at all times.
